"kinesthetic response" captures how movement in one part of the body, like the arms, can naturally and dynamically engage the rest of the body. Despite the usual kinetic chain sequence, this kinesthetic response allows the body to adapt and move fluidly in response to the arm movements.
If you’ve struggled to contort your body into positions that you see with tour players then consider trying something different! In this video I explain how the arms play a vital role in shifting the low point forward!

my right shoulder is psyco...it wants to start the swing by rushing down to the ball...it's so dominant that near the end of a round when I'm tired it will do it on some of my chips and even putts....so the question is, how do I start the downswing in such a manner that this doesn't happen...telling myself to hold the torso back as the downswing begins is much harder than one would think...

Ah, the dreaded ‘Psycho Trail Shoulder!’ I would bet that you’re not getting enough ‘depth’ at the top with your trail hip & shoulder!! You need to create enough space to allow your arms to win the race. Try hitting balls off a tee with your right foot BACK! This will effectively ‘detain’ that psycho shoulder!! 🤣 Get after it. I believe that I need to incorporate this feeling of moving my left arm indecently of my torso's rotation both through transition and impact.Presently I have about 6 degrees of shaft lean at impact and would like a little more. I have always understood that the hands should exit left post impact. Is this the case if one incorporates slinging the arms through impact, provided that the body rotates well through impact as well? Re transition, would it be fair to say as one recenters at the top of the backswing and then moves pressure forward at the start of the downswing, one almost feels a "surfing" feeling? During this short moment in time the back and pelvis remain turned to the target and the arms drop simply due to gravity with no intentional speed added to the arms during the "surf"? Once the arms reach delivery this is when speed is added to the arms and they are slung through impact as a result of the front leg pressing hard into the ground? Yes to questions 1 & 2 and, No, to question 3. You need to feel speed with your arms earlier in the transition. Peak arms speed is just below P6 at which point we ‘brake’ the lead leg and lead arm to create angular momentum. Remember creating speed is as much about deceleration as it is acceleration! So, is this kind of a SLINGING motion? … slinging the clubhead before your right shoulder gets to the ball? This makes a lot of sense, but … It’s so hard to keep the upper body back 🙄
@AndrewEmeryGolf
@AndrewEmeryGolf 2 месяца назад
It’s highly likely that you need to get the trail hip and shoulder more behind you at the top! That’s the big challenge for most who feel like they can’t keep their back to the target as they change direction. I would say the vast majority of my students don’t pivot well in the backswing! Try hitting balls with your trail foot back to give your arms a pocket. Best, Coach A. 🏌️‍♂️⛳️🙏🏻
